The Maverick Battalion conducted a spring staff ride on Friday at the National Medal of Honor Museum analyzing the battles of Gettysburg and Vicksburg. Senior Cadets each played a role in researching a key leader in each battle and explained the impacts of those leaders actions or inactions and the impacts to the battle.

Special thanks to Ken Smith of our alumni counsel to help facilitate the discussion and analysis of the battles.

Congratulations to our very own Cadet De La Garza for being recognized at the Cadet of the Week.

Today we visit "The Lone Star State" for our Army ROTC 🎉

Meet Luisa De La Garza, a junior majoring in Criminal Justice at the The University of Texas at Arlington.

She joined to become a better leader and develop stronger discipline.

"Since I was a kid, I have always wanted to be in the Army and be part of something greater
than myself. I envision myself becoming an Infantry officer and one day earning my Ranger
tab, then transitioning into Military Intelligence to lead and develop a higher level of
operational skills."

As a member of the Maverick Battalion, De La Garza has held numerous leadership roles and is part of the Sam Houston Rifle, Color Guard, and the ODM Ranger Challenge Team.

"Joining ROTC has been one of the best decisions I have ever made. Not only have I
developed meaningful friendships, but I have also been given incredible opportunities to
lead."

De La Garza is motivated to lead by her father who motivates her to be better in everything she sets out to do.

"I have always seen him find solutions to problems and never quit. Seeing him wake up every day
motivates me to be the best I can be, not just for myself, but for both of us."

Fun fact: De La Garza loves boxing and has competed in national-level tournaments.
